Cleanscope

C+ 70 completed
Mobile App
web_app / markdown · small
203
Files
47,608
LOC
4
Frameworks
11
Languages

Pipeline State

completed
Run ID
#353936
Phase
done
Progress
1%
Started
Finished
2026-04-13 01:31:02
LLM tokens
0

Pipeline Metadata

Stage
Cataloged
Decision
proceed
Novelty
80.00
Framework unique
Isolation
Last stage change
2026-05-10 03:35:38
Deduplication group #55109
Member of a group with 1 similar repo(s) — this repo is canonical view group →
Top concepts (2)
Project DescriptionWeb Frontend
Hi, dataset curator — please cite Repobility (https://repobility.com) when reusing this data.

AI Prompt

I want to build a privacy-respecting Android application that streams live video from a USB endoscope directly to the device. The project should utilize SvelteKit for the frontend and potentially incorporate Tauri for desktop compatibility if needed. Since the core functionality involves video streaming and hardware interaction, please structure the project to handle this efficiently. I see that the repository also includes markdown and JSON files, so please ensure the structure supports documentation alongside the main application logic.
svelte sveltekit tauri android video-streaming rust typescript privacy web-app
Generated by gemma4:latest

Catalog Information

A privacy‑respecting Android application that streams live video from a USB endoscope to the device.

Description

The application allows users to connect a USB endoscope to an Android device and view the live video feed directly on the screen. It focuses on privacy by ensuring that no video data is stored or transmitted beyond the local device. The interface is lightweight, built with modern web technologies, and offers real‑time playback with minimal latency. It targets medical professionals, technicians, and hobbyists who need a portable inspection tool. The solution solves the problem of cumbersome desktop setups and privacy concerns associated with cloud‑based endoscope viewers.

الوصف

يتيح التطبيق للمستخدمين توصيل منظار USB بجهاز أندرويد وعرض البث المباشر للصور مباشرة على الشاشة. يركز على الخصوصية من خلال ضمان عدم تخزين أو نقل بيانات الفيديو خارج الجهاز المحلي. واجهة المستخدم خفيفة الوزن، مبنية على تقنيات الويب الحديثة، وتوفر تشغيلًا فوريًا مع تأخير منخفض. يستهدف الأطباء، والفنيين، والهواة الذين يحتاجون إلى أداة فحص محمولة. يحل المشكلة المرتبطة بإعدادات سطح المكتب المعقدة ومخاوف الخصوصية المرتبطة بمشاهدات المنظار عبر السحابة. يدمج التطبيق دعمًا كاملاً للكاميرات USB مع واجهة سهلة الاستخدام، مما يتيح فحصًا دقيقًا للمكونات الداخلية للآلات أو الأجهزة. يضمن التطبيق أمانًا عاليًا للبيانات، مع الحفاظ على تجربة مستخدم سلسة وموثوقة.

Novelty

6/10

Tags

usb-camera-support real‑time-video-streaming privacy‑focused medical-imaging device-inspection android-integration

Technologies

svelte vite

Claude Models

claude-opus-4.5 claude-opus-4.6 claude (unknown version) claude-sonnet-4.6 claude-haiku-4.5

Quality Score

C+
70.1/100
Structure
60
Code Quality
72
Documentation
45
Testing
75
Practices
80
Security
100
Dependencies
60

Strengths

  • CI/CD pipeline configured (github_actions)
  • Good test coverage (40% test-to-source ratio)
  • Code linting configured (biome)
  • Good security practices \u2014 no major issues detected

Weaknesses

  • Missing README file \u2014 critical for project understanding
  • No LICENSE file \u2014 legal ambiguity for contributors
  • 2026 duplicate lines detected \u2014 consider DRY refactoring
  • 8 'god files' with >500 LOC need decomposition

Recommendations

  • Add a comprehensive README.md explaining purpose, setup, usage, and architecture
  • Add a LICENSE file (MIT recommended for open source)
  • Address 32 TODO/FIXME items \u2014 consider tracking them as issues

Security & Health

14.1h
Tech Debt (A)
A
OWASP (100%)
PASS
Quality Gate
A
Risk (1)
Repobility · code-quality intelligence · https://repobility.com
MIT
License
9.1%
Duplication
Full Security Report AI Fix Prompts SARIF SBOM

Languages

markdown
44.5%
json
30.7%
rust
19.6%
svelte
2.1%
typescript
0.8%
xml
0.7%
yaml
0.7%
kotlin
0.7%
toml
0.2%
html
0.0%
javascript
0.0%

Frameworks

Svelte SvelteKit Tauri Vite

Concepts (2)

Data scored by Repobility · https://repobility.com
CategoryNameDescriptionConfidence
Methodology: Repobility · https://repobility.com/research/state-of-ai-code-2026/
auto_descriptionProject DescriptionPrivacy-respecting USB endoscope viewer for Android80%
auto_categoryWeb Frontendweb-frontend70%

Quality Timeline

1 quality score recorded.

View File Metrics

Embed Badge

Add to your README:

![Quality](https://repos.aljefra.com/badge/78053.svg)
Quality BadgeSecurity Badge
Export Quality CSVDownload SBOMExport Findings CSV